Under Data Type, selectDate & time.4. Current period vs. previous period WITHOUT date column DAX Calculations corkemp September 14, 2020, 3:53am #1 Hi everyone, I think this is relatively simple, but I haven't been able to find the right solution for it. Start of Period is simple. Sales = SUM(FactResellerSales[SalesAmount]) instead of Sales = SUM(FactInternetSales[SalesAmount]), I might have used the wrong measure name but the tale name looks alright to me . However, if you do not have data after December 25, 2008, you might want to compare only the same range of days (December 1 to 25) in the year-over-year comparison. This exercise diverted time from planning and forecasting analytics to lower-value forensic analysis. There is also an ability in this chart that may not be visible to everyone, and that is the breakdown option of this chart. Comparing different time periods - DAX Patterns Germany others might stumble upon it. If you want to get the sales for last months; then ParallelPeriod is your friend. Actually, I have another suggestion tell me what you think about it. the screenshot below shows it; For example; for September 2006, SamePeriodLastYear returns September 2005. Great - thank you so much! All of that is done for you just by using this visual! Make sure to download our FREE PDF on the 333 Excel keyboard Shortcuts here: depends on the context. Previous period calculation should be number of days in this period minus start of current period. Our next task is to show CP Value and PP value based on start date and End Date, on top of the line chart to improve the readability of the view. ), Please provide tax exempt status document, What To Consider When Comparing Current vs. You have to use this function as a filter function. The sales of the comparison period must be adjusted using the number of days in each period as the allocation factor. DAX Patterns: Standard time-related calculations, Using calculation groups or many-to-many relationships for time intelligence selection, Understanding blank row and limited relationships, Using calculation groups or many to many relationships for time intelligence selection, Show the initial balance for any date selection in Power BI Unplugged #48, Counting consecutive days with sales Unplugged #47. In the photo below the current period slicer is showing 6/1/2021-6/30/2021 and the previous period slicer is showing 5/1/2021-5/31/2021. As an example; if user selected a date range from 1st of May 2008 to 25th of November 2008, the previous period should be calculated based on number of days between these two dates which is 208 days, and based on that previous period will be from 5th of October 2007 to 30th of April 2008. In September, an analyst can report to management that although they have seen negative numbers nine months in a row, the situation has steadily improved and looks to end the year on a positive note. DateAdd can be used in a Day level too. For those differences, Ive created two additional measures: Lower Card is conditionally formatted based on the values, so it goes red when we are performing worse than in the previous period, while it shows green when the outcome is the opposite: Now, thats fine and you saw how we could easily answer the original question. Hi @parry2k,I have considered creating measures for a monthly, quarterly, and yearly comparison, but the problem I foresee with this method is when management says they want to see a quarterly comparison instead of a monthly comparison, all the measures will have to be switched out on the visual to show the new time comparison. The sales of the comparison period must be adjusted using the number of days in each period as the allocation factor. Good job. (as of December), Weve had nine straight months of poor sales, but its getting better. (as of September), This was our second-worst year, well below average.. Reza is an active blogger and co-founder of RADACAD. Time intelligence calculations in DAX are usually created considering consecutive periods in any type of comparisons. All other rows that aren't flagged as "today" or "previous day . Download the sample files for Power BI / Excel 2016-2019: Keep me informed about BI news and upcoming articles with a bi-weekly newsletter (uncheck if you prefer to proceed without signing up for the newsletter), Send me SQLBI promotions (only 1 or 2 emails per year). While I would argue that a dashboard with a cycle plot and year-to-date totals would be the most appropriate for this situation, it wont be the right choice for everything. They also have high scalability, which means we can apply the level of detail expressions in this kind of charts .Lets learn how to create a comparison line chart view that displays the sum of sales for all the mentioned period by following these steps: 2. The key to using the breakdown feature is to understand how it works. By breaking it down into quarters, we can still answer basic questions related to seasonality. In the example we are considering, the selection made on the slicer shows just a few months. The PreviousYearMonth variable is used to filter the Year Month Number in the CALCULATE function that evaluates Sales Amount for the previous selected month: The technique shown in this article can be used whenever you need to retrieve a previous item displayed in a Power BI visualization where non-consecutive items are filtered and the requirement is to consider strictly the items that are selected and visible. I see values, however, in the year of 2007, which is compared to 2008. Read more, When you apply a multiple selection to a slicer or to a filter, you obtain a logical OR condition between selected items. This pattern is included in the book DAX Patterns, Second Edition. It gives you information for a period over period values. However, the variance of the change compared to 2006, for the Graduate Degree is higher than the High School, and that is why Graduate Degree comes earlier in the sorting. Comparing with previous selected time period in DAX - SQLBI If you wish to get the benefits that drywall has to offer like the benefits mentioned in this article, then now is the time to take action. What Is the XMLA Endpoint for Power BI and Why Should I Care? This will make the entire report dynamic and eliminate the need for a measure for each time range. I would also like the user to be able to choose which report cycles they want to compare - they select the first and last report cycles to compare. Cheers Hi PBI users, I'm looking to create a dynamic SAMEPERIODLASTYEAR calculation. I will give credit to the freelancer who came up with this at the end of the post.End Result:You will have one slicer for the current period and one slicer for the previous period. This approach might not work well when the requirement is to compare the differences between a selection of non-consecutive periods. you need three parameters for this function: ParllelPeriod(
Aerofly Fs 2 Keyboard Controls,
Rivals For Catan Era Of Gold Rules,
What Happened To Tony On Love Boat,
Super Dave Osborne Voice Problem,
New Restaurants Coming To Acworth,
Articles C
current period vs previous period comparison in power bi